Connections
~Connections is a new advisory program here at the middle school.~Groups of 11-13 students are assigned to one adult advisor.~Groups meet twice a month for 30 minutes where they complete lessons and activities related to a monthly school-wide theme.
![Page 15: Welcome Parents and Guardians! Please initial next to your child’s name](https://reader035.vdocument.in/reader035/viewer/2022062716/56649de95503460f94ae3476/html5/thumbnails/15.jpg)
Advisory programs have been known to:
~ Help students grow emotionally and socially~ Contribute to a positive school climate~ Enhance student-teacher relationships~ Promote mutually respectful relationships
with peers~ Improve students’ decision-making and
communication skills~ Create a sense of belonging to school~ Improve student learning

Positive Behavior Interventions & Supports(PBIS)
Research shows that preventing violence in schools involves:– Positive, predictable school-wide climate– High rates of academic & social success– Formal social skills instruction– Positive active supervision & reinforcement– Positive adult role models– Multi-component, multi-year school-family- community
effort
These are the same elements for a positive school climate

Student Success Plan Overview (SSP)
The Student Success Plan (SSP) is an individualized, student driven plan that will be developed to address every student’s needs and interests to help every student stay connected in school and to achieve postsecondary educational and career goals.
Connecticut State Department of Education Student Success Plan Overview
![Page 41: Welcome Parents and Guardians! Please initial next to your child’s name](https://reader035.vdocument.in/reader035/viewer/2022062716/56649de95503460f94ae3476/html5/thumbnails/41.jpg)
What is required from school systems in Connecticut?
The SSP will begin in the 6th grade and continue through high school to provide support and assistance in setting goals for:
• Social, emotional, physical and academic growth.• Meeting rigorous high school expectations. • Exploring postsecondary education and career interests.
Connecticut State Department of Education, 2012
